Role
What you would be doing

  • Leads contractor meetings on a regular basis
  • Assists in Time and Materials (T&M) tracking
  • Plans, coordinates, and manages jobsite logistics
  • Creates, manages, and updates the project schedule, creating and implementing contingency plans when necessary
  • Obtains or verifies that subcontractors obtain all necessary permits for construction purposes
  • Directs the day-to-day coordination of Gilbane’s trade contractors and their sub-contractors to ensure high-quality work that meets the approved project schedule
  • Trains direct report Field Engineers and Superintendents on project needs, construction knowledge, and business acumen
  • Establishes credibility among owners, trade contractors, unions, and other project partners by maintaining a fair and trustworthy environment
  • Assists in general requirements financial forecasting
  • Aids in communicating company and department strategy to direct reports
  • Develops, documents, and communicates the work plan regarding changes made in the field
  • Acts as primary safety representative in the field and enforces safety compliance with all trades
  • Reviews and supports writing scopes of work and participates in buyout
  • Develops the Quality in Construction (QIC) plan in partnership with the Operations Excellence team, oversees the plan and implements necessary changes
  • Communicates schedule status, updates and changes to project team and trade contractors
  • Maintains daily reports and documentation using software tools
  • May be required to assist with tasks typically assigned to more junior positions
  • Fosters a positive and inclusive work environment to motivate and engage team members
  • Trains direct reports on processes, procedures, and completion of daily tasks
  • Maintains a thorough understanding of contract documents in order to proactively anticipate potential problems
  • Manages workload and performance of direct reports, ensuring alignment with overall company standards
  • Communicates with Site Services/Next 150 to order materials and schedule crew
  • Leads stretch and flex, daily huddle, and pre-task plan reviews
  • Collaborates closely with business development to ensure seamless integration with sales strategies including performance metrics on your assigned projects, pursuits, and client deliverables. Actively participates in opportunities to strengthen client, partner, and industry relationships that position Gilbane as the “Builder of Choice”

  • Ability to create an environment where “safety first” is the culture and all trades people work with an incident and injury free attitude
  • STS-C Certification
  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or Construction Management
  • Construction-document and drawing literate, with knowledge of all phases of construction
  • Excellent problem-solving skills and ability to adapt to changing needs
  • First Aid, CPR, AED, Stop the Bleed Training
  • Hyperscale data center experience is required
  • Knowledge of suite of construction software tools, including logistics and scheduling software
  • 7-12 years of experience leading a component of work or whole project for a value of $50 million or larger on commercial/industrial construction project(s) in a superintendent role
  • Ability to collaborate on a daily basis with the project team
  • Experience and proficiency in most divisions of work, methods, materials, scheduling, and cost control
  • Strong technical and communication skills
  • Or equivalent combination of education and experience
  • Ability to work in a team environment
  • Strong knowledge and appreciation of construction safety processes and ability to enforce the project safety plan
  • Excellent organizational skills
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office
  • OSHA 30-hour certified
